Our cycle-7 archive project to study X-ray thermal coronae in nearby hot clusters has resulted in the discovery of more than 80 new coronae in 0.1 - 14 L* cluster galaxies. Relevant important physics, e.g., heat conduction, viscosity, SN heating and AGN feedback, can be constrained from the studies of these embedded mini-cooling cores. We propose follow-up on-axis observations of two luminous coronae (with the highest observed flux in our sample) and one faint corona to further understand: 1) The internal structure and energy balance of the embedded coronae (in unprecedented detail); 2) The X-ray faint coronae of massive galaxies; 3) Corona cooling and SMBH activity.
